Started in March 2021 and stretching more than one-third mile (five hundred metres) along the South Bank of the River Thames, opposite the Palace of Westminster, the mural consists of approximately 150,000 red and pink hearts, intending to have one for each of the casualties of COVID-19 in the United Kingdom at the time of the mural's commencement.The intent was for each heart to be "individually hand-painted; utterly unique, just like the loved ones we’ve lost""

The marker reads:
"The National Covid Memorial Wall
created by bereaved families

The hearts on this wall are in memory of our fellow citizens who have died since March 2020 with Covid-19 on their death dertificates.
Every heart represents a person who was loved.
The well belongs to us all, and we all have to share it. If you want to add an inscription to the wall in memory of someone whose life was lost to Covid-19, please abide by the original principles:

- Please only take one heart for one person
- Find a freshly painted heart and make your dedication
- Hearts should be similar in size and no larger than an adult hand

The Friends of the Wall are a group of bereaved volunteers who maintain the memorial by removing graffiti, repeated inscriptions and re-painting fading hearts. All efforts are being made to maintain original dedications.
